Abstract

An entertainment apparatus ( 1 ) comprising two upright walls ( 3 a, 3 b ), each having an inner surface. A plurality of game pieces ( 9 ) are located in the space ( 5 ) between the walls ( 3 a, 3 b ), each of the game pieces ( 9 ) being in contact with the inner surface of at least one of the walls ( 3 a, 3 b ).Each of the game pieces ( 9 ) comprises a drive assembly for moving the game piece over that inner surface, the drive assembly comprising a traction element ( 11 ), such as a wheel, for generating traction against the inner surface and an actuator for moving the traction element relative to the surface. At least one, and preferably both, of the walls ( 3 a, 3 b ) are transparent, for example they are glass, such that a user can observe the game pieces ( 9 ) within the space ( 5 ), from outside the apparatus ( 1 ).

1 . An entertainment apparatus comprising:
 two upright walls, each having an inner surface, the inner surfaces facing each other and being spaced apart to define a space there-between, and   a plurality of game pieces located in the space between the inner surfaces of the walls, each of the game pieces being in contact with the inner surface of at least one of the walls, and each of the game pieces comprising a drive assembly for moving the game piece over that inner surface, the drive assembly comprising a traction element for generating traction against the inner surface and an actuator for moving the traction element relative to the surface such that the game piece moves,   and wherein   at least one of the walls is transparent such that a user can observe the game pieces within the space, from outside the apparatus.   
     
     
         2 . An entertainment ap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ein both the walls are transparent such that the game pieces can be observed from either side of the apparatus. 
     
     
         3 . An entertainment apparatus according to  claim 1  or  claim 2 , wherein the movement of the game pieces is unconstrained, such that they are freely moveable, in any direction, over the inner surface. 
     
     
         4 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, wherein the apparatus comprises a wireless communication system arranged to wirelessly communicate a user input to at least one of the game pieces, such that said game piece is wirelessly controllable via the user input. 
     
     
         5 . An entertainment apparatus according to  claim 4 , wherein the apparatus comprises a control system for controlling the plurality of game pieces with control signals, and the communication system is arranged to wirelessly communicate the control signals to the game pieces. 
     
     
         6 . An entertainment apparatus according to  claim 4  or  claim 5 , wherein the user input is an instruction to move the game piece(s), and the drive assembly of said game piece(s) is arranged to move its respective game piece in response to the user input. 
     
     
         7 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, wherein each game piece is simultaneously in contact with the inner surfaces of both walls. 
     
     
         8 . An entertainment apparatus according to  claim 7 , wherein each game piece comprises biasing means, the biasing means being arranged to press outwardly against the inner surfaces of the walls such that the weight of the game piece is at least partially supported. 
     
     
         9 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, wherein each game piece is capable of maintaining its vertical position in the space. 
     
     
         10 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, wherein the apparatus comprises a power source for powering the drive means of the game pieces. 
     
     
         11 . An entertainment apparatus according to  claim 10 , wherein the power source comprises a plurality of power storage elements, each power storage element being part of a respective game piece. 
     
     
         12 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, the apparatus being arranged to track the location of each game piece in the space. 
     
     
         13 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, wherein the apparatus comprises an opening for enabling ingress or egress of the game pieces from the space. 
     
     
         14 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, wherein the apparatus comprises an opaque boarder adjacent to at least part of the transparent wall, the game pieces being moveable behind the opaque border such that they can be re-located around the perimeter of the space without being seen by the user. 
     
     
         15 . An entertainment apparatus according to any preceding claim, wherein the game pieces are decorated differently so as to represent different characters or objects. 
     
     
         16 . An entertainment apparatus as herein described with reference to the drawings.
